In a surprising turn of events, a White House lawyer is now speaking out claiming that former President Donald Trump accepted gifts such as robes made from the furs of white tigers and cheetah as well as a dagger made from ivory.

The lawyer is claiming that many of these items which, was not disclosed by Trump, violate the Endangered Species Act, however Trump still kept them.

According to Yahoo News, the items were seized by U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service and later discovered to actually have been fake!

“Wildlife inspectors and special agents determined the linings of the robes were dyed to mimic tiger and cheetah patterns and were not comprised of protected species,” spokesperson for the Interior Department Tyler Cherry said.
